Re: Bug#680096: ATLAS on PowerPC



"brian m. carlson" <sandals@crustytoothpaste.net> writes:

> POWER3 is 64-bit.

But still POWER3 is supported by the 32-bit powerpc port:

 http://www.debian.org/releases/stable/powerpc/ch02s01.html.en#id522279

>  PPCG4 is 32-bit, but it requires the use of Altivec
> instructions, which G3 processors do not have.  So the answer is that
> neither of these is acceptable by default.

My understanding is that POWER3 does not have Altivec, so it may
therefore be the best option.

> Is there a reason that you cannot use the
> defaults of the compiler?

Yes, it has to do with the Atlas build system which does CPU detection
and timings at compile time, and which is quite intricate (to say the
least).
